JDU Leaders Meets Union Minister Ramnath Thaukar, Seeks Crop Insurance Implementation and Hailstorm Compensation for Shopian

Janata Dal (United) leaders from Jammu and Kashmir, led by South Kashmir In-charge Mashooq Ahmad Under The Leadership of GM Shaheen, met Union Minister for Agriculture and Farmers’ Welfare, Ramnath Thaukar , at Party office Srinagar.

During the meeting Mashooq Ahmad submitted a memorandum demanding urgent implementation of the Crop Insurance Scheme in Jammu and Kashmir, particularly for apple growers and farmers of the Shopian district. They also sought full and timely compensation for orchardists whose produce was severely damaged in the recent hailstorm that hit the area.

The memorandum highlighted that farmers in Shopian suffered massive losses due to unseasonal weather, and the lack of a robust insurance mechanism had left many growers in economic distress.

Union Minister Ramnath Thaukur gave a patient hearing and assured the delegation that the matter would be taken up seriously with concerned departments. He assured full cooperation from the Union Government in addressing the concerns of the farming community.

The macadamisation work on the much-awaited Chitragam Zainapora Link Road has finally commenced, bringing immense joy and satisfaction to the local residents. The project, being executed by the Roads & Buildings (R&B) Department Zainapora, is being widely appreciated by the community who had long demanded better road infrastructure in the area.
